From fc5c154ac7bb7a8966dd021b7c7eed093577cdfe Mon Sep 17 00:00:00 2001 From: Alexis Fourmaux Date: Wed, 24 Sep 2025 17:53:22 +0200 Subject: [PATCH] =?UTF-8?q?Ajoute=20=C3=A9valuation=20sur=20le=20cours=20d?= =?UTF-8?q?e=20num=C3=A9ration?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../evaluations/numeration-operateurs.md | 38 +++++++++++++++++++ src/cours/SUMMARY.md | 1 + 2 files changed, 39 insertions(+) create mode 100644 src/cours/CIEL1/02-reseau/evaluations/numeration-operateurs.md diff --git a/src/cours/CIEL1/02-reseau/evaluations/numeration-operateurs.md b/src/cours/CIEL1/02-reseau/evaluations/numeration-operateurs.md new file mode 100644 index 0000000..1200b2a --- /dev/null +++ b/src/cours/CIEL1/02-reseau/evaluations/numeration-operateurs.md @@ -0,0 +1,38 @@ +# Évaluation - Représentation des nombres + +#### 1 - Convertissez les nombres suivants en **décimal** + +- $1001~0101_{|2}$ +- $\mathrm{6A0B}_{|16}$ + +#### 2 - Convertissez les nombres suivants en **binaire** + +- $137_{|10}$ +- $\mathrm{3C7}_{|16}$ + +#### 3 - Convertissez les nombres suivants en **hexadécimal** + +- $542_{|10}$ +- $1101~0001~1011~1110_{|2}$ + +#### 4 - Sur le nombre suivant, indiquez le bit de poids faible (LSB) et le bit de poids fort (MSB) + +- $1101~0001~1011~1110_{|2}$ + +#### 5 - Combien d'entiers peut-on représenter avec un nombre de 8 bits ? + +#### 6 - Mon ordinateur m'indique qu'un fichier fait 17 432 624 octets. Combien cela représente-t-il environ (2 chiffres après la virgule, attention aux unités) + - en Mo (Mégaoctets) ? + - en Mio (Mébioctets) ? + +#### 7 - Mon SSD a une capacité de 256 Go (Gigaoctets). Combien cela représente-t-il en Gio (Gibioctets) ? + +#### 8 - Donnez la table de vérité du ET logique + +#### 9 - Donnez le résultat des opérations booléennes suivantes si A = True et B = False +- `not (A and B)` +- `A or not B` + +#### 10 - Donnez le résultat de l'opération bit à bit suivante (Attention, les nombres sont en base 10) + +- `57 | 78` \ No newline at end of file diff --git a/src/cours/SUMMARY.md b/src/cours/SUMMARY.md index 3c667ce..d5a13e0 100644 --- a/src/cours/SUMMARY.md +++ b/src/cours/SUMMARY.md @@ -5,6 +5,7 @@ - [TD1 - Représentation des nombres](./CIEL1/02-reseau/td/td01-numeration.md) - [TD1 - Représentation des nombres - Correction](./CIEL1/02-reseau/td/_td01-correction.md) - [TD2 - Adresse IP](./CIEL1/02-reseau/td/td02_adresse_IP.md) + - [Evaluation - Représentation des nombres](./CIEL1/02-reseau/evaluations/numeration-operateurs.md) - [Bases de l'algorithmique avec Python](./CIEL1/01-bases-python/algorithmique-python.md) - [Cours - 1 - Bases](./CIEL1/01-bases-python/cours/python-bases-1-variables-operateurs.md) - [Cours - 2 - Structures de contrôle](./CIEL1/01-bases-python/cours/python-bases-2-structures-controle.md)